לכל חשבון צוות ב-Shopify מוצמד תפקיד שקובע אלו חלקים של ה-Admin נגישים לו: הזמנות, מוצרים, לקוחות, דוחות, הגדרות תשלום ועוד. בעל החנות (Store owner) הוא התפקיד הבכיר היחיד שאי אפשר להסיר או להגביל — הוא גם היחיד שיכול לבצע העברת בעלות (Change ownership) ולגשת לחיוב. שאר התפקידים ניתנים להתאמה חופשית מתוך Settings → Users and permissions.

בחנויות ישראליות עם צוות מגוון (מחסנאים, שירות לקוחות, מנהלי תוכן) כדאי להגדיר תפקידים מינימליים לפי עיקרון ה-least privilege: מחסנאי צריך גישה למלאי אבל לא לדוחות פיננסיים, ומנהל תוכן צריך עריכת מוצרים אבל לא גישה לפרטי לקוחות. הגדרה נכונה מפחיתה חשיפה לנתונים רגישים ומונעת שגיאות אדמין בלתי הפיכות.